But what does "Tapped Out" mean in terms of gambling? First, let us dive into the casino glossary to understand the roots of this gambling term.
In the world of gambling, "Tapped Out" refers to a player who has exhausted all of their financial resources, either in casinos or online. It indicates that the player has reached the limit of money they can wager, as they are "out" of funds. This term implies that the player has either bet all their money or reached a level where they cannot make further bets without having a negative bankroll.
